概括
一个新的PROTAC分子,180055有效降解癌细胞中的多 (ADP-ribose) 聚合酶1 (PARP1). 这种有针对性的方法为传统的PARP1抑制剂提供了更安全的替代方案,对BRCA突变瘤有希望.
科学领域:
- 生物化学和分子生物学
- 癌症治疗方法 癌症治疗方法
- 药物发现 药物发现 药物发现
背景情况:
- 聚 (ADP-ribose) 聚合酶1 (PARP1) 对于DNA修复至关重要,也是癌症治疗的目标.
- 现有的PARP1抑制剂面临着由于DNA捕获和非目标效应的挑战.
- 需要改进的PARP1向疗法,具有更好的安全性.
研究的目的:
- 使用蛋白质降解技术开发针对PARP1的新型治疗策略.
- 为了合成和评估一种用于PARP1降解的蛋白质溶解向合体 (PROTAC) 分子.
- 在临床前癌症模型中评估PROTAC分子的疗效和安全性.
主要方法:
- 一个PROTAC分子 (180055) 的合成,将基于Rucaparib的部分与VHL连接体结合在一起.
- 在体外评估PARP1降解和酶抑制.
- 评估DNA陷效应和非目标活动.
- 在BRCA突变模型中的瘤细胞杀死以及对正常细胞的影响的体外和体内研究.
主要成果:
- 在PROTAC分子180055高效和选择性降解PARP1.
- 在没有显著的DNA捕获的情况下,PARP1酶活性被抑制.
- 180055证明了选择性杀死BRCA突变瘤细胞.
- 在体外和体内都观察到对正常细胞生长的影响最小.
结论:
- 合成的PROTAC分子180055有效地降解PARP1,具有高效率和安全性.
- 180055代表了一种有前途的新疗法候选人,用于同类重组缺陷的癌症,如BRCA突变瘤.
- 需要对180055进行进一步的临床研究.
